The Verj project was one of five in Victoria that received $350,000 from the State Government.
The project involved developing the space between the median strip and the skate park.
The launch included community activities, a barbecue and an exhibition of Natimuk Primary School students' work.
Former Premier and Arts Minister Ted Baillieu and Member for Lowan Hugh Delahunty spoke at the launch.
A kinetic sculpture by Sam Deal, named 'The Thing' was also unveiled.
Project manager Carolynne Hamdorf said the sculpture fit with the sustainable focus of the project's design.
"It's a kinetic sculpture, which is one of the key creative components of The Verj," she said.
She said it was exciting to see the project officially opened.
